Best Jordan 2 Colorways 2022: Top Picks From The Latest Designs


There's a lot to take into account when deciding upon the best Jordan 2 colorways as, despite the silhouette being over 35 years old, Nike is still creating new designs to this day.

The sneakers first debuted in 1986 after the huge success of the Jordan 1, and despite the original being a tough act to follow, it's safe to say the Jordan 2 made a lasting impact, even garnering high-profile collaborations like the upcoming Jordan 2 x A Ma Maniére release.

Best Looking Jordan 2 Colorway - Air Jordan 2 "Black History Month"

Not only is there a great message behind the "Black History Month" release, but we believe it is one of the best-looking Jordan 2 colorways as well.

Black leather dresses the upper, however, you get a number of integrated dynamic patterns across the black surfaces which draw inspiration from traditional African Kente cloth.

This motif is continued around the heels in red and blue which match the multi-colored outsoles that also bring yellow into the equation.

Furthermore, hints of gold make their way to the Nike and 'BHM' logos on the heel counters, thus rounding off this excellent "Black History Month" design.

Best Jordan 2 Collaboration Colorway - Off-White x Jordan 2 Low "White Red"

The Off-White x Nike collaboration from 2021 saw the brands release two great colorways, but we feel the "White Red" low-tops are the real standout from the selection.

What we like about this colorway, in particular, is the number of signature Off-White details present across the simple white leather base with contrasting black laces.

Most notably, the midsoles have been artificially yellowed and are presented as though they are decaying, with translucent rubber filling in the gaps.

Moreover, the sneakers feature Michael Jordan's signature printed on the lateral sides which is a nice touch to tie these designer sneakers back to wear it all began.

Best Jordan 2 Retro Colorway - Air Jordan 2 Retro "Melo"

When Carmelo Anthony was drafted to the Denver Nuggets in 2003, Jordan instantly signed the young prospect right out of the gate as he showed the polish of a top-tier professional athlete.

To celebrate 15 years since Anthony's debut, Nike produced this excellent Retro colorway called the "Melo" based on the 2004 Player Edition.

Much of the upper remains consistent with the OG release, with the whole sneaker dressed in Denver colors, and nods to Carmelo are littered throughout like his shirt number and name inscribed on the insoles.

Ultimately, when it comes to Retro re-releases, we feel the "Melo" Jordan 2 colorway is up there as one of the best.

Are Jordan 2's Comfortable?

In our guide on whether Jordan's are comfortable, we state that because all Jordan's include Nike's Air technology, they should be relatively comfortable to wear every day.

One of the most important aspects for making sure your Jordan 2's are comfortable though is to make sure you get the right fit right.

We'd recommend leaving about a finger's width of space between your longest toe and the end of the shoe as this will make sure your sneakers are bending in the correct place as it should align to the natural bend of your foot.

Are Jordan 2's True To Size?

It's widely acknowledged that most Jordan sneakers fit true to size; however, you may find going a size up to be beneficial if you plan on playing basketball in your Jordan 2's and have slightly wider feet as this should ensure your feet remain comfortable and supported.

Can You Run In Jordan 2's?

We've gone into detail on whether Jordan's can be used for running and, in the said article, we state that while it is possible to run in Jordan's, like the 2's, we'd advise selecting dedicated running shoes instead.

This is mostly down to Jordan 2's being considerably heavier than most running trainers which, in a 2016 study into the weight of shoes, is found to make you 1% slower for every 3.5 ounces of lead added per shoe.

Also, while the higher collars provide ankle support on the court, you may find them quite restrictive whilst running.
